<u>Solution-</u>

The given equation is,

\Rightarrow 4x + 2y = 8

\Rightarrow 2y = 8-4x

\Rightarrow y =\dfrac{8-4x}{2}

\Rightarrow y = 4-2x

\Rightarrow y = -2x+4

Comparing it with the general slope-intercept form of straight line,

\Rightarrow y = mx+c

Here,

m = slope = -2

y-intercept = 4

As the slope is negative in this case, so option B and option D are incorrect.

Now, calculating the x intercept,

\Rightarrow y = 0

\Rightarrow -2x+4=0

\Rightarrow 2x=4

\Rightarrow x=2

So the x intercept is 2.

As in the option A, the y-intercept appears to 4 and x-intercept appears to be its half i.e 2. So option A is the correct graph.
